Clearwater

Good reports in the last week. Even with a small bump in the flows, anglers are still swinging up a few. When the river bumps, look for slower inside seams and keep your flies down and slow. Go with black Kilowatts, Hickman's Fish Tacos, Mark's Goblins, and Hot Bead Steelhead Stone Nymphs.

Snake River(WA)(ID)

Fishing well, with two uplifting reports this week. Water is still cold, so run the proper tip to get you down to the fish. Key here is to keep moving down the run and covering water, but keep the flies low and slow. Takes can be gentle now so don't be afraid to set on those "plucky" grabs. Check your hook often when running tips as the fly will be dragging in the rocks more often. Don’t miss an opportunity to a dull hook. Black and purple are always good options for the winter, or try swinging smaller rubberleg nymphs. I've had great success during the cold snaps with downsized colorful rubberleg nymphs. Any of the nymphs with hot beads work great, either on the swing or under an indicator.
